Malevolent Creation is a death metal band originally hailing from Buffalo, New York. Moving to Florida in 1988, they became a part of the emergent local death metal scene, landing a deal with Roadrunner Records. Their debut album, The Ten Commandments, became something of a landmark in the death metal underground, expanding on the early work of Slayer and fellow Floridians Death.

According to a series of posts published at blabbermouth.net, Phil Fasciana claimed (via several emails he sent to Blabbermouth.net) he was involved in a shootout in which he shot and killed a man who he says was robbing a store he was in.

Discography

Studio Albums

  • The Ten Commandments, (Roadrunner Records, 1991)
  • Retribution (Roadrunner Records, 1992)
  • Stillborn (Roadrunner Records, 1993)
  • Eternal (Pavement Music, 1995)
  • In Cold Blood (Pavement Music, 1997)
  • The Fine Art of Murder (Pavement Music, 1998)
  • Envenomed (Arctic Music, 2000)
  • The Will to Kill (Arctic Music, 2002)
  • Warkult (Nuclear Blast, 2004)
  • Doomsday X (Nuclear Blast, 2007)
